Pilatus P3-03 Aircraft

The Pilatus P3 is a vintage military-style trainer for buyers who want classic European trainer character, formation/fun flying, and collectable ownership rather than practical personal transport. It is not a PC-12-adjacent utility aircraft; the value is in airframe condition, engine support, restoration quality, and parts availability. Compared with a Yak or other vintage trainer, the P3 has its own support network and documentation questions.

Pilatus P3-03 Specifications

Model spec

The Pilatus P3-03 is a 2-seat single engine piston with a cruise speed of 148 kt (274 km/h), a range of 400 nm (741 km), and a useful load of 900 lbs (408 kg).

Performance
Cruise148 kt (274 km/h)
Max Speed170 kt (315 km/h)
Range400 nm (741 km)
Service Ceiling18,000 ft (5,486 m)
Engine & Fuel
Horsepower240 HP
Fuel Burn12.0 GPH (45 L/h)
Weights & Seats
Seats2
Max Gross Weight3,307 lbs (1,500 kg)
Useful Load900 lbs (408 kg)

Buying a Used Pilatus P3-03

Buying a Pilatus P3-03 comes down to a focused pre-purchase checklist — here is what matters most on this model:

What to check before buying

The defining cost driver is vintage trainer support. Engine condition, airframe fatigue, corrosion, parts availability, restoration records, and specialist maintenance access determine whether ownership is realistic.

Frequently Asked Questions — Pilatus P3-03

Is the Pilatus P3 related to the PC-12 mission?
No. The P3 is a vintage trainer, while the PC-12 is a modern utility/business turboprop.
Who should buy a Pilatus P3?
A specialist owner who wants vintage trainer flying and has confirmed support access.
What should buyers check on a P3?
Engine support, airframe condition, corrosion, restoration records, parts availability, logs, and specialist maintenance.
